This 4.8km out-and-back route offers a refreshingly flat and fast running experience along the West Sussex coastline. Starting from the heart of Littlehampton, you'll head out onto Arun Parade before hitting the wide, paved Promenade that stretches toward Rustington. With a total ascent of 0m, it is an ideal course for runners looking to set a personal best or enjoy a steady recovery run while breathing in the salty sea air. The terrain is predominantly paved, making it accessible in all weather conditions, though you should be prepared for a bracing coastal breeze if you're running against the wind on the return leg.
The area around the River Arun and the Littlehampton seafront is steeped in maritime history and serves as the gateway to the South Downs. As you run past the iconic "Longest Bench" and the East Beach Cafe—a striking piece of modern architecture—you are following a coastline that has evolved from a busy 19th-century port into a beloved seaside destination. The mouth of the River Arun is a focal point for the town, and local runners often time their sessions to catch the dramatic sunsets over the pier, which provide a spectacular backdrop to an evening workout.
